Transaction 25e4b6c499c73988cb93be3b949cfb022ce39561c3875659e9bfffe10a89a47d

1 Input
2 Outputs
  • 25e4b6c499c73988cb93be3b949cfb022ce39561c3875659e9bfffe10a89a47d:0
  • value  1306667
    address  3JxmHwaY2YN4vjXfriTxbZn4gbwHRRdwsG
  • 25e4b6c499c73988cb93be3b949cfb022ce39561c3875659e9bfffe10a89a47d:1
  • value  93282653
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v